  1. In Texas we have too many governments. In many states, the school board is not a separate governing body, but a board of the county (some appointed, some elected) who develop education policy and are not separate taxing entities. Those must depend on the city or county governing body for funding and are subject to more oversight than Texas School Districts. So, in Texas we have corruption to get that money controlled by poor management and corrupt management...but Trustees that are poorly equipped to run such an endeavor. BISD funds are fought over by lots of unscrupulus people who, like ticks, want to bite into the BISD veins for a taste of that tax payer blood. Alliances of BISD teachers and employees bother me as much, because their focus too is on their interests....which usually don't include what's best for the students or for the tax payers.
